While we are on the topic of EVs, I recently ran across a bombshell about EPA range. Apparently many cars are penalized for having different charging options (e.g. choosing to charge to 80% to avoid battery wear), and the EPA rates based on the manufacturer recommended charge level rather than a full charge. For some reason EPA lets Tesla rate at 100% battery despite having selectable charge levels.
Just getting this out there because it seems super important, most EV discussions end up boiling down to "meh, poor range" or something, when it seems that the playing field may be skewed. https://www.greencarreports.com/news...-electric-cars |

February 24, 2020
The debut for the full electric BMW iX3 is getting closer as the prototypes are now appearing in different colors. Also see here for the first time are the Aerodynamic Wheels exclusive to the iX3. BMW has officially published that the iX3's range is rated at 440 KM (WLTP) and feature a 74 kWh battery. The electric motor featured in the BMW iX3 delivers a maximum power output of 210 kW/286 hp and 400 Nm torque.
